Caravan external shower Yes or No?


I'm having a van built and have included an external shower in the build. The van will have a full en suite. Is an external shower overkill / needed? At almost $500 for the fit, I'd appreciate feedback from anyone who has one. Cheers Keith

We've got one and never used it. Friends have them and most have never used theirs either. Never seen one in use at any of the sites we've stayed. I could find better things to spend $500 on.

I agree, with a full en suite, I doubt it would ever get used. The only use I can think of is perhaps if you have kids and camp near the beach or a river and you want to give them (or maybe yourselves) a rinse when they come out of the water.

Spend it on solar or an extra battery I reckon...

I've got exterior hot/cold shower and attached shower tent.....in addition to Caravan Ensuite which does get the use........never used the exterior set up...can't get Granddaughter to use it either...prefers to bring her sandy feet into the Van ensuite after a swim.....ensuite toilet and showers have special fascination for kids.....its the space on site and time to set up that makes me leave it all packed and unused....probably the only additional accessory on my Van that has never been used...Hoo Roo

We took one away with us but never used in over 104 nights on the road - if we had used it we would have lost precious water plus have the problem of standing in mud unless you are standing on concrete. A few litres of hot water and a flannel kept us pure.
